AI Summary
-
Allows Tennessee's annual hospital coverage assessment to be implemented even if one specific CMS approval (subdivision (b)(1)(B)) has not yet been obtained, provided all other CMS determinations and confirmations are in place
-
Limits directed payments to hospitals under this partial-approval scenario to either the FY 2024 amount established in 2023 Public Chapter 232, or a higher amount determined by the division in consultation with the Tennessee Hospital Association, up to the CMS-approved cap
-
Expenditure limitations remain in effect until all required CMS approvals are obtained and the division provides written notice to the Tennessee Hospital Association
-
Passed the legislature on March 24, 2025 and signed by Governor Bill Lee on April 3, 2025
-
Takes effect immediately upon becoming law due to public welfare necessity
Legislative Description
A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Title 71, Chapter 5, relative to the annual coverage assessment.
